Transaction b4476161ecc26402a0576ba68091601c5406ba2de25c9d0ab352b73db048712e
1 Input
1 Output
-
b4476161ecc26402a0576ba68091601c5406ba2de25c9d0ab352b73db048712e:0
- value
- 258736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aab5c1e2169b08dc45247ecc5e5fbd873cc26009 OP_EQUAL
- address
- 3HFeXsquGAMuSZt5hV9xg7cyw7basTha4t